Air Liquide is searching for an exceptional individual to reinforce our Process Safety team as a Process Risk Management Representative (PRMR).

The Process Risk Management Representative (PRMR) is responsible for executing "risk control" duties. This role focuses on maintaining operational risk management, ensuring reliability, and complying with external regulations, all within the framework of Group policies. A key responsibility of the incumbent is to partner with operational teams to perform field-based reviews and risk assessments, ensuring the continuous management of process hazards.

What You'll Do:

  • Implementing the annual plan for the process risk assessment of existing operations.

  • conducting process risk assessments taking into account the Facility specific environment

  • supporting the Facilities and Activities in the implementation of the validated process risk reduction measures.

  • Participates in root cause investigations related to process safety risks, and follow up actions.

  • Conducting process risk assessment required by the projects and changes required

  • Participating in Pre-Startup Safety Reviews (PSSR) and Ready to Operate Review ( RTOR) as defined in the relevant protocols

  • Performing reviews in the field to confirm the effectiveness of the validated process risk reduction measures.

About Airgas

Airgas, an Air Liquide company, is a leading U.S. supplier of industrial, medical and specialty gases, as well as hardgoods and related products; one of the largest U.S. suppliers of safety products; and a leading U.S. supplier of ammonia products and process chemicals.

Dedicated to improving the performance of its more than 1 million customers, Airgas safely and reliably provides products, services and expertise through its more than 18,500 associates, over 1,100 locations (including branches, fill plants, and production sites), robust e-Business platform, and Airgas Total Access® telesales channel.
